根据下面列出的“物联网智能设备灯控系统”的用户需求,说说你的硬件设计和软件设计的思路。200字
时间: 2024-04-02 16:35:42 浏览: 50
在设计“物联网智能设备灯控系统”时,我们需要考虑以下用户需求:1.支持手机APP远程控制灯光开关和亮度调节;2.支持语音控制灯光开关和亮度调节;3.支持定时开关灯光功能;4.支持联动控制多个灯光设备。因此,我们可以选择使用ESP32-C3作为主控芯片,使用ESP32-C3模块和WiFi模块实现联网功能,使用PWM控制器实现灯光亮度调节,使用语音识别芯片和手机APP实现远程控制和语音控制功能,使用RTC实时时钟芯片实现定时开关功能。在软件设计方面,我们可以使用Arduino IDE或者ESP-IDF进行开发,具体实现方式包括:编写WiFi模块的驱动程序,实现WiFi联网功能;编写PWM控制器的驱动程序,实现灯光亮度调节;编写语音识别芯片和手机APP的驱动程序,实现远程控制和语音控制功能;编写RTC实时时钟芯片的驱动程序,实现定时开关灯光功能。综上所述,我们需要综合考虑用户需求、硬件设计和软件设计,才能实现一个功能强大、易于使用的物联网智能设备灯控系统。
阅读全文